引言
在现代网络环境中,V2Ray 是一个非常受欢迎的代理工具,它为用户提供了高效、安全的网络访问。许多用户需要对 V2Ray 的二进制文件进行复制和重新配置,以适应不同的使用场景和需求。本文将详细介绍这一过程,包括具体步骤、常见问题及注意事项。
什么是V2Ray?
V2Ray 是一个网络代理工具,支持多种协议和传输方式。它的主要功能包括:
- 科学上网,突破网络封锁。
- 提供隐私保护,防止网络监控。
- 支持多种传输协议,提高访问速度。
复制V2Ray二进制文件的准备
在复制 V2Ray 的二进制文件之前,你需要做好以下准备:
- 确认V2Ray已正确安装:确保你已经在你的系统上安装了 V2Ray,并能正常使用。
- 找到V2Ray的安装路径:一般情况下,V2Ray 的二进制文件会存放在
/usr/local/bin/v2ray
或者/usr/bin/v2ray
。 - 备份配置文件:为了避免出现意外情况,请务必备份原有的配置文件。
复制V2Ray二进制文件的步骤
1. 打开终端
在你的操作系统中,找到并打开终端。对于Linux用户,通常是使用 Ctrl + Alt + T 快捷键。
2. 输入复制命令
在终端中输入以下命令: bash cp /usr/local/bin/v2ray /desired/path/to/v2ray_copy
将 /desired/path/to/v2ray_copy
替换为你想要存放复制文件的路径。
3. 检查文件复制情况
使用 ls
命令来检查复制的文件是否存在: bash ls /desired/path/to
确认 V2Ray 二进制文件已成功复制。
重新配置V2Ray
1. 备份原始配置文件
在进行任何更改之前,请备份原始配置文件,通常位于 /etc/v2ray/config.json
。 bash cp /etc/v2ray/config.json /etc/v2ray/config_backup.json
2. 编辑配置文件
使用文本编辑器(如 vim
或 nano
)打开配置文件: bash nano /etc/v2ray/config.json
根据你的需要修改配置选项,如端口、UUID等。常见的配置项包括:
- inbounds:配置入站连接。
- outbounds:配置出站连接。
3. 验证配置文件
使用以下命令验证配置文件是否正确: bash v2ray -test -config /etc/v2ray/config.json
如果一切正常,将显示验证成功的信息。
4. 重启V2Ray服务
bash systemctl restart v2ray
注意事项
- 文件权限:确保复制后的二进制文件具有可执行权限,可以使用
chmod +x /desired/path/to/v2ray_copy
来设置。 - 配置文件格式:请确保 JSON 格式正确,避免因格式错误导致 V2Ray 无法启动。
- 监控服务状态:在重启服务后,可以使用
systemctl status v2ray
来监控 V2Ray 的运行状态。
常见问题解答 (FAQ)
Q1: V2Ray二进制文件可以复制到哪个地方?
A1: 你可以将 V2Ray 的二进制文件复制到任何可执行路径下,比如 /usr/local/bin
、/usr/bin
或者用户自己的文件夹。
Q2: 如何确认我的V2Ray是否工作正常?
A2: 你可以使用 curl
命令来检查 V2Ray 是否正常工作,比如: bash curl -x socks5://127.0.0.1:1080 http://www.example.com
如果能成功访问,说明你的 V2Ray 正常工作。
Q3: 重新配置后,V2Ray无法启动怎么办?
A3: 首先检查你的配置文件是否存在语法错误,使用 v2ray -test
命令进行验证。如果依然无法解决问题,可以查看日志文件,通常在 /var/log/v2ray/error.log
。
Q4: V2Ray支持哪些协议?
A4: V2Ray 支持多种协议,如 VMess、VLESS、Shadowsocks、Trojan等,用户可以根据需要进行选择和配置。
结论
通过复制和重新配置 V2Ray 的二进制文件,用户可以根据自己的需求灵活调整代理设置,提升网络体验。希望本文能够帮助你顺利完成这些操作,并对 V2Ray 的使用有更深入的理解。